St. Anne's-Belfield was the 3-0 winner over Saint Gertrude when they last played one another back in September, but their luck changed this time around. The St. Anne's-Belfield Saints fell just short of the Saint Gertrude Gators by a score of 3-2 on Tuesday.
St. Anne's-Belfield took a 2-1 lead headed into the fourth set, but sadly they lost the next two. The match finished with set scores of 25-14, 21-25, 22-25, 25-21, 15-5.
St. Anne's-Belfield's defeat ended a three-game streak of away wins and brought them to 11-6. As for Saint Gertrude, they are on a roll lately: they've won five of their last six games, which provided a nice bump to their 7-7 record this season.
St. Anne's-Belfield has already played their next matchup, a 3-0 loss against The Covenant on the 10th. As for Saint Gertrude,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 3-2 defeat against Veritas School on the 10th.
